Job Description

**This is a Full Time, client based position at 40 hours per week located at the Crystal Lake clinic. Schedule is Monday through Friday.**

The Sports Performance Personal Trainer - Lead reflects the mission, vision, and values of NM, adheres to the organization’s Code of Ethics and Corporate Compliance Program, and complies with all relevant policies, procedures, guidelines and all other regulatory and accreditation standards.

The Sports Performance Personal Trainer – Lead assumes the primary role in the supervision, development and implementation of department-related initiatives and demonstrates team building skills to facilitate team engagement and growth.

This position includes direct client contact, mentoring and departmental process improvement initiatives.

Serves as a role model for all personal trainers in all aspects of professional, clinical communication, education and leadership activities.

The Lead places the needs of the client as top priority and demonstrates the skills necessary to meet and exceed expectations.

Must possess a high degree of energy, resourcefulness and reliability as well as exhibit excellent interpersonal skills and professional behavior. Must be able to maintain a good rapport with physicians, clients and family, other team members in adjacent departments and the community. Must be able to supervise employees in a fair, objective, and tactful manner.

A personal trainer who complies with the Code of Ethics/Standards of Practice. This position includes direct client care, teaching, participation on appropriate committees and departmental process improvement. Serves as a role model for all personal trainers and interns in all aspects of professional, clinical, communication, education and leadership activities.

Responsibilities:

  • Demonstrates the NM Values of teamwork, patients first, integrity and excellence in daily work and interactions with others.
  • In collaboration with the manager and director, is actively involved in the operational aspects of department operations to support unit specific programs and organizational initiatives.
  • Presents a friendly, approachable, professional demeanor and appearance.
  • Maintains open lines of communication with other departments and leaders in the organization.
  • Coordinates daily work activities of employees including schedule/assignments, vacation time and schedule changes.
  • Enforces policy and procedures
  • Trains new employees.
  • Ensures all clients are scheduled and receive the appropriate services by ongoing monitoring of schedules and billable standards.
  • Assesses adequate staffing levels and participates in the employee interview process to ensure all candidates meet standards for hire. Assists Manager in orienting new staff.
  • Provides timely, positive, constructive feedback and holds staff accountable for change as evidenced by observation and peer feedback.
  • Contributes information as part of the performance appraisal process. Works with the Manager in addressing performance gaps as they occur with clear action plans and recommendations for improvement.
  • Identifies potential problems or opportunities in processes or personnel and communicates them to the Manager/Director along with recommendations for improvement.
  • Assists with the development of policies and procedures that reflect current operational standards.
  • Participates in the planning, development and implementation of department and program related initiatives to reduce costs, streamline work processes, improve and grow services provided within the department.
  • Fosters a culture of respectful communication by listening, asking for input, open discussions, and timely acknowledgement of individual and team contributions.
  • Uses effective service recovery skills to solve problems or service breakdowns as they occur, keeping leader appraised of any issues.
  • Maintains department financial records and collects payments from clients. Adjusts patient fee schedules based on individual needs.
  • Provides input for equipment and major purchase decisions. Authorizes purchase of supplies.
